Brighi heading back Rome
Thursday 24 May, 2007
Chievo midfielder Matteo Brighi will return to Roma once his loan expires at the end of the season, but he may not stay there for too long.

The Italian has spent the last three seasons in Verona where he has refined his potential and he’s now keen to make his mark with the Giallorossi.

“One thing is certain and that is that he will return to base,” noted agent Vanni Puzzolo. “I’ve spoken to Roma and there seems to be an intent to extend his contract.

“Brighi would certainly like to be a part of the Roma squad next season. He’s 25 now and is keen to play at the highest levels in Serie A and on the European stage.”

Nevertheless, the representative has admitted that Brighi would have plenty of options open to him if space proves to be limited in the capital.

“There are a host of mid-table sides and lower who are ready to snap him up, clubs like Fiorentina – he’s wanted by practically all the clubs in Serie A,” added Puzzolo.

“Roma would never give him out on a full loan now even if he may be included in a player plus cash transfer with somebody else.”

Brighi, capped once at full international level, was snapped up by Juventus in 2000 from then Serie C2 club Rimini.

Yet he never really left his mark in Turin and was loaned to Bologna, Parma and Brescia before being included in the transfer which saw Emerson leave Roma for Juve in 2004.
